Virtual HR Forum ~ Rubicon & Ellis Jones
Equality, Diversity & Inclusion
Rubicon Recruitment and Ellis Jones Solicitors are delighted to invite you to our complimentary Virtual HR Forum, a monthly webinar for HR professionals and business leaders to explore key HR and employment law topics with like-minded professionals.
September’s HR Forum will focus on Equality, Diversity & Inclusion (EDI), exploring the latest case law developments and the legal and commercial implications for employers. As expectations around workplace culture continue to evolve, HR professionals have a vital role to play in creating inclusive environments while ensuring legal compliance.
Our HR Forums are designed to support organisations in navigating the UK employment law landscape, providing expert insight, practical guidance, and the opportunity to share best practice with peers.
Hosted by Jo West (Rubicon Recruitment) and Kate Brooks (Partner & Head of HR and Employment Law Partner, Ellis Jones), this session will support HR professionals in staying compliant, confident, and prepared as flexible working shifts from a benefit into an expected default.
Topics We’ll Explore In This HR Forum:
-
An update on the latest Equality, Diversity & Inclusion case law and what it means for employers
-
The legal and commercial implications of failing to create an inclusive workplace
-
Practical guidance on taking all reasonable steps to prevent sexual harassment
-
Understanding employer responsibilities in relation to third-party harassment
-
Best practice for policies, training, reporting procedures and creating a positive workplace culture
